What is ISO 9001? ISO 9001 is the international standard for Quality Management Systems (QMS). It helps organizations demonstrate their ability to consistently provide products that meet customer and regulatory requirements. The standard is applicable to any organization regardless of size or industry, and is based on seven quality management principles including customer focus, leadership, engagement of people, process approach, improvement, evidence-based decisions, and relationship management [3].

ISO 9001 Certification Process: Stage 1 audit confirms processes are in place. Stage 2 is evidence of implementation and effectiveness. Full internal audit and management review required before certification.

Stainless Steel Material Grades: Stainless steel offers excellent corrosion resistance and durability, making it suitable for harsh environments in automotive and industrial applications. The 300 series accounts for 56.18% of market share, while duplex grades are growing fastest at 5.29% CAGR [2]. For on-board chargers and similar industrial products, common grades include 304 (general purpose), 316 (marine/chemical environments), and 430 (cost-effective alternative).

Global and Regional Market Trends for Certified Industrial Products

The global market for ISO certification is substantial and growing. According to industry analysis, the global ISO certification market was valued at USD 10.26 billion, with Asia Pacific holding 23% of global revenue, driven by manufacturing growth and export compliance requirements in Southeast Asia [1].

Asia Pacific ISO Certification Market (2024): China USD 1.06B, Japan USD 325.6M, India USD 283.1M, South Korea USD 235.9M, Southeast Asia USD 162.8M. India shows fastest growth at 18.8% CAGR [1].

For stainless steel specifically, market volume is projected to grow from 13.37 million tons in 2025 to 17.63 million tons by 2031, at a CAGR of 4.72%. The automotive sector shows the fastest growth at 5.27% CAGR, driven by electric vehicle adoption and infrastructure development [2].

Key Buyer Concerns Identified:

  1. Certificate Verification: Buyers increasingly verify certifications directly with issuing labs due to prevalence of fake or outdated certificates. 2. Proven Capacity: Never trust stated capacity, only trust proven output — start with smaller test orders. 3. Technical Credibility: LinkedIn and digital outreach work but need technical credibility and certifications immediately. 4. Trust Over Price: For industrial products, trust matters more than price, which is why trade fairs and verified platforms like Alibaba.com remain valuable.

Important Considerations:

ISO 9001 is not a product quality certificate — it certifies your quality management system, not individual products. Buyers understand this distinction. • Stainless steel grade selection should match your target application — 304 for general use, 316 for corrosive environments, 430 for cost-sensitive markets. • Certification verification is increasingly common — buyers may contact your issuing lab directly. • Alternative pathways exist — some buyers accept supplier audits in lieu of ISO certification for smaller orders.
